There’s something about those dumplings at Din Tai Fung
In 1993 Din Tai Fung in Taipei was voted one of the world’s top ten restaurants by the New York Times. Din Tai Fung serves dumplings and noodle based dishes in somewhat humble canteen like surroundings. Today Din Tai Fung has branches all over the world and several in Taipei.
